M&T Bank is a financial institution seeking a Product Manager IV to provide strategic direction for multiple product lines and services. The role involves designing products, developing market strategies, and ensuring successful implementation while maintaining compliance with legal and regulatory requirements.
Responsibilities:
- Sets strategic direction for assigned product lines, and presents business plans to senior management and employees
- Directly responsible for product pricing, cost structure, as well as product risk. Responsible for all product financials including revenue planning and product profitability
- Responsible for sales channel strategy. Review new developments in company markets, evaluating and recommending new services, new products or geographies, or the modification of existing services or products. Evaluate new product/services success; implement and manage changes in service or marketing strategy
- Manage all aspects of new product implementation and existing product modification to include but not limited to the design and development of services, portfolio acquisition and process improvements; act in a liaison capacity with affected departments
- Establish marketing objectives; work with other bank departments to develop effective programs to sell services/products
- Ensure product/services are marketable, profitable and comply with legal and regulatory requirements
- Maintain an awareness of new trends and developments in marketing and company products and services. Develop and provide ongoing group and individual training for staff in regard to presentation skills, product knowledge and best practices and procedures
- Understand and adhere to the Company’s risk and regulatory standards, policies and controls in accordance with the Company’s Risk Appetite. Identify risk-related issues needing escalation to management
